CSK vs KKR: Total Head-to-Head Results

Across all IPL seasons up to 2025, Chennai Super Kings and Kolkata Knight Riders have played 32 matches against each other. CSK holds a comfortable lead, winning 20 of those games. KKR has managed 11 victories, and one match ended without a result.

CSK’s highest total in this rivalry stands at 235, while KKR’s best is 202. On the flip side, CSK’s lowest score is 103, and KKR’s lowest is 107. Both teams can post huge totals and crumble under pressure, making every encounter between them unpredictable.

CSK vs KKR in All Seasons

Here is a full breakdown of the results between CSK and KKR in every IPL season:

SeasonResult
2025Kolkata Knight Riders won by 8 wickets | Chennai Super Kings won by 2 wickets
2024Chennai Super Kings won by 7 wickets
2023Chennai Super Kings won by 49 runs | Kolkata Knight Riders won by 6 wickets
2022Kolkata Knight Riders won by 6 wickets
2021Chennai Super Kings won by 18 runs | Chennai Super Kings won by 2 wickets | Chennai Super Kings won by 27 runs
2020Kolkata Knight Riders won by 10 runs | Chennai Super Kings won by 6 wickets
2019Chennai Super Kings won by 7 wickets | Chennai Super Kings won by 5 wickets
2018Chennai Super Kings won by 5 wickets | Kolkata Knight Riders won by 6 wickets
2015Chennai Super Kings won by 2 runs | Kolkata Knight Riders won by 7 wickets
2014Chennai Super Kings won by 34 runs | Kolkata Knight Riders won by 8 wickets
2013Chennai Super Kings won by 4 wickets | Chennai Super Kings won by 14 runs
2012Kolkata Knight Riders won by 5 wickets | Chennai Super Kings won by 5 wickets | Kolkata Knight Riders won by 5 wickets
2011Chennai Super Kings won by 2 runs | Kolkata Knight Riders won by 10 runs
2010Chennai Super Kings won by 55 runs | Chennai Super Kings won by 9 wickets
2009Kolkata Knight Riders won by 7 wickets | Match abandoned without a ball being bowled
2008Chennai Super Kings won by 9 wickets | Chennai Super Kings won by 3 runs

Note: CSK was suspended from the IPL during the 2016 and 2017 seasons due to the 2013 betting case. There were no matches between the two sides during that period.

Biggest Wins And Memorable Matches

This rivalry has seen some truly lopsided results from both teams. Here are the standout victories and unforgettable clashes:

Chennai Super Kings’ Biggest Wins

CSK vs KKR 2010

CSK’s most emphatic victory came in 2010, when they crushed KKR by 55 runs. That same year, they also won by 9 wickets with 39 balls to spare, which remains one of their most comfortable chases against KKR. In 2023, CSK hammered KKR by 49 runs in Chennai, with their bowlers running through the KKR lineup. Over the years, bowlers like Ravindra Jadeja, R. Ashwin, and Deepak Chahar have troubled KKR’s batting on multiple occasions.

Kolkata Knight Riders’ Biggest Wins

CSK vs KKR 2025

KKR’s most dominant result against CSK came in IPL 2025, when they chased down a target of just 104 in only 10.1 overs, winning by 8 wickets with 59 balls still remaining. It was CSK’s heaviest defeat in terms of balls remaining in IPL history. In 2009, KKR also had a strong run against CSK, winning their only completed game that season by 7 wickets. The 2020 encounter saw KKR beat CSK by 10 runs in Abu Dhabi with a spirited bowling display.

IPL Finals: CSK vs KKR on the Biggest Stage

What makes this rivalry even more special is that these two teams have met in two IPL finals. In 2012, KKR chased down CSK’s total of 190 at Chepauk, with Manvinder Bisla scoring a stunning 89 off 48 balls to seal a 5-wicket win and KKR’s maiden IPL title.

The tables turned in 2021, when CSK beat KKR by 27 runs in the final at Dubai. Faf du Plessis scored 86 to power CSK to 192, and Shardul Thakur picked up 3 wickets as KKR’s batting collapsed from 91/0 to 165/9. CSK lifted their fourth IPL trophy that night.

Recent Form: CSK vs KKR

Over the last few seasons, the two teams have traded wins, making this rivalry tighter than the overall numbers suggest. Here is a look at the most recent meetings between CSK and KKR:

SeasonVenueWinnerMargin
2025Kolkata (Eden Gardens)Chennai Super Kings2 wickets
2025Chennai (Chepauk)Kolkata Knight Riders8 wickets
2024Chennai (Chepauk)Chennai Super Kings7 wickets
2023Kolkata (Eden Gardens)Kolkata Knight Riders6 wickets
2023Chennai (Chepauk)Chennai Super Kings49 runs
2022Pune (DY Patil)Kolkata Knight Riders6 wickets
2021DubaiChennai Super Kings27 runs
2021Abu DhabiChennai Super Kings2 wickets

CSK had a dominant run in 2021, sweeping all three games against KKR, including the IPL final. KKR fought back in 2022, winning their only meeting that season. CSK regained control in 2023 and 2024. In 2025, the results split evenly. KKR handed CSK a humbling 8-wicket defeat in Chennai, but CSK got their revenge in Kolkata, winning by 2 wickets in a tense chase where MS Dhoni hit a six off the first ball of the final over to guide his team home.

Key Players In CSK vs KKR Matches

Here are the players who have left their mark on the CSK vs KKR rivalry:

Top Run-Scorers

Suresh Raina has been the highest run-scorer in CSK vs KKR games across the history of the IPL. His ability to shift gears in the middle overs and play match-winning knocks defined many CSK victories in this matchup. MS Dhoni is the next on the list, with his calm finishing ability proving decisive in several tight games. For KKR, Gautam Gambhir was the standout in the early years, while Shubman Gill and Venkatesh Iyer have stepped up in more recent seasons.

Top Wicket-Takers

Sunil Narine holds the record for the most wickets in CSK vs KKR matches with 23 scalps. His mystery spin and ability to control the flow of runs in the middle overs make him a constant threat to CSK batters. On the CSK side, Ravindra Jadeja leads the way with 20 wickets against KKR. His tight left-arm spin, combined with sharp fielding has been a thorn in KKR’s side for years. R. Ashwin also features high on the list with his wickets in the earlier seasons.

Standout Performances

One of the most iconic individual efforts in this rivalry belongs to Manvinder Bisla, who scored 89 off 48 balls in the 2012 IPL final, helping KKR win their first title. In the 2021 final, Faf du Plessis played a masterful 86 to lead CSK to their fourth crown. In IPL 2025, Sunil Narine smashed 44 off just 18 balls while also picking up 3 wickets to single-handedly destroy CSK in Chennai.

Conclusion: CSK Leads The Rivalry With 20 Wins Against KKR

Over 32 matches, Chennai Super Kings have established a clear lead over Kolkata Knight Riders. They lead 20-11 in the overall record and have won one of the two IPL finals played between these sides. CSK’s consistency under MS Dhoni’s leadership, their strong squad depth, and their ability to perform in crunch situations have made them the stronger team in this matchup.

But the Kolkata Knight Riders are a franchise that refuses to stay down. Their 2012 final win, their 2024 title triumph, and their aggressive brand of cricket mean they always pose a challenge. Players like Sunil Narine, Andre Russell, and Rinku Singh give KKR the firepower to beat any team on their day.

Whenever CSK and KKR face off, fans know they will get an entertaining game. CSK may hold the lead in the head-to-head, but this rivalry has plenty more chapters left to write.
